A beautifully presented Victorian family home set on a quiet residential road on the borders of St Margaret's and Old Isleworth.
Spanning 1,355 sq ft, the property is presented in immaculate order, arranged over three floors and offers well-proportioned rooms throughout.
The wonderfully light ground floor accommodation consists of a lovely double reception room complete with hardwood floors, original shutters and open plan to the kitchen/breakfast room at the rear. There is a well-maintained westerly-facing garden that can be accessed from the kitchen/breakfast room.
On the first floor, the property offers two spacious double bedrooms and a beautifully appointed family bathroom.
The converted loft provides a spacious principal bedroom with an en suite shower room and a further bedroom/study.

The property is located on Eve Road, a quiet residential road situated on the borders of St Margarets and Isleworth.
St Margarets has a great selection of small independent shops, restaurants and pubs and numerous cafes with outdoor seating, giving the area a very distinctive cosmopolitan feel.
The mainline station from St Margarets provides a regular service to London Waterloo and connections to the underground at Richmond.
The River Thames is within a comfortable stroll of the property, with pleasant walks across Richmond Lock to The Old Deer Park, Richmond town centre and Old Isleworth.
